Saint George's Bay, Bermuda. 32 22.5N, 64 40.5W.

We finally arrived here on the 27th April after another Sea Spray epic.

We had a day of absolute calm and finished off in a gale, and in between I managed to tear the cruising chute in a squall, the charging system failed and so we had to hand steer during the last three days, but the boat handled very well in the gale with just the yankee up in the end.
